Senior Software Engineer, Data Platform

Strava is the app for active people, aiming to motivate individuals to live their best active lives. They are seeking a Senior Software Engineer to help grow their data platform, which is crucial for decision-making and supports various company functions through robust data analysis infrastructure.

Responsibilities

Collaborate with people across teams and functions that hold deep curiosity for data
Work with hefty data systems at the global scale of Strava, supporting functions including analytics, AI/ML, engineering, and finance, and help strengthen our infrastructure as we grow
Deliver value more through software, leaning into tooling and automation rather than repetitive toil
Grow your expertise in the steadily evolving technologies and ecosystem of data
Building scalable software solutions to existing data problems utilizing modern data technologies
Writing high quality and reliable code that supports our end user experience
Understanding that data security and privacy is of utmost importance
Holding empathy for the users of our platform to truly understand the challenges we address for them
Fostering an inclusive and motivating team culture to help everyone achieve their best

Qualification

PythonSQLDistributed data processingCloud data warehousesData infrastructureScalaJavaGoRubyKubernetesAWSGCPAzureSoft skills

Required

Have 3+ years of experience developing data-intensive software using languages like Python, Scala, Java, Go, or Ruby, with the ability to evaluate and adopt new technologies as business needs evolve
Be comfortable reading and reasoning about SQL queries in data pipeline contexts (e.g., dbt models), understanding how transformations impact downstream systems
Have hands-on experience working with distributed data processing tools (e.g., Spark, Flink, Kafka) on production datasets, with an understanding of their tradeoffs and appropriate use cases
Have built or maintained data pipelines using cloud data warehouses (e.g., Snowflake, BigQuery, Redshift), Data lakes (e.g., Iceberg, Hudi) or similar solutions, understanding performance optimization and cost considerations
Understand the underlying infrastructure needed to serve production data platforms (e.g., Kubernetes, AWS, GCP, Azure), including experience deploying and managing data infrastructure components like clusters, storage systems, and compute resources
